The story is about a young man that we took into our family earlier this year after he had been homeless for three years.

He aged out of the state foster care system and like many others had no support system and found himself alone on the streets of Phoenix.

Jose was not the first young adult that we took into our home from the streets, but he had many more challenges to battle. After living on the streets for three years, he had to deal with legal issues, immigration issues, and drug issues, but with a lot of love and grace, we watched God transform Jose’s life into a beautiful work of redemption for His glory.

Jose now lives with my sister and her husband, and he finished his recovery program and all of his court issues are resolved. He works full time and just got promoted into a manager position. He also plays soccer twice a week and is an amazing athlete.

Jose is now 23, and he actively participates in helping with all of our projects to feed and love on the homeless, as well as provide gifts and goodies for the kids in state foster care. His heart is pure and his future is bright!
